Definitions
[ˈjuːnɪs(ə)n], (Noun)
Definitions:
- simultaneous performance or utterance of action or speech
(e.g: ‘Yes, sir,’ said the girls in unison)
- coincidence in pitch of sounds or notes
(e.g: the flutes play in unison with the violas)
Phrases:
Origin
:
late Middle English (in unison): from Old French, or from late Latin unisonus, from Latin uni- ‘one’ + sonus ‘sound’
[ˈjuːnɪs(ə)n], (Adjective)
Definitions:
- performed in unison
(e.g: unison congregational singing)

[ˈjuːnɪs(ə)n], (Noun)
Definitions:
- (in the UK) a trade union formed in 1993 and representing employees in the health service and public sector
